On July 12, Mr. Tran Quoc Nam, Deputy Secretary of the Provincial Party Committee, Chairman of the Provincial People's Committee went to check the construction progress of the new construction of the Southeast canal and the section of Tan Tai canal in the Southeast urban area; the construction of central conditioning reservoir; Huynh Thuc Khang Street of Coastal Cities Sustainable Environment Project - City Subproject. Phan Rang - Thap Cham.
According to the investor's report on the progress of the project, the city must recover land and compensate 1.311 households and organizations. Up to now, there have been 1.278 households and organized to hand over the premises (reaching 98%), 4 households have not received money but have agreed to hand over the premises. Currently, there are 33 households who have not agreed to hand over the premises. For the new construction package of the Southeast canal and the section of Tan Tai canal in the Southeast urban area, the construction units are implementing 8 construction projects, the construction volume is 91%, expected to be completed on time. Package PR-1.9 to build central air conditioning reservoir is still entangled with 20 households who have not yet handed over the ground. Currently, the central lake construction unit is implementing 2 construction works for waste transportation and 2 construction and installation projects, reaching the progress of 15,2%. Particularly for the PR-2.2 package on Huynh Thuc Khang street, there are still 8 households that have not yet handed over the premises. Currently, the unit is implementing 3 construction steps, reaching the volume of 12,4%…
